Spinach Salad

Ingredients

16 oz package fresh spinach
4 hard cooked eggs, sliced
1/2 cup diced onions
1/2 lb crumbled bacon
1 cup sliced fresh mushrooms
Dressing:
2/3 cup sugar
1/4 cup vinegar
1/2 cup vegetable oil
1/3 cup ketchup
1 tsp salt
1 tsp worcestershire sauce

Procedure

  1. Toss salad ingredients together in a large bowl.
  2. Mix dressing ingredients. Just before serving, add dressing and toss, or have individuals add their own dressing.

Serves 10. Per Serving: Calories 265; Calories from fat 162(61%); Fat 18g; Carbohydrates 19g; Sugar 17g; Fiber 1g; Protein 8g
